Responsibilities

  • Identify, evaluate, and implement cost-saving opportunities, developing reports to assist management in tracking overall 340B Program Compliance and financial impact to the organization.
  • Prepare, monitor, and report on 340B program metrics, documenting utilization, savings, problem areas, and/or discrepancies to pharmacy and administrative leadership.
  • Assist in the implementation of policies and procedures and ensure uniform compliance, utilizing time tracking tools for accurate project planning and budgeting needs.
  • Oversee the implementation of process improvement initiatives for the 340B program, creating an environment of continuous monitoring and improvement.
  • Implement strategies for the appropriate use of the program working directly with manufacturers and wholesalers, and assess opportunities for cost savings, business and system improvements.
  • Manage relationships, billing services, and compliance with contracted 340B pharmacies, and evaluate current and future contract pharmacy opportunities.
  • Support covered entities with 340B, GPO, and WAC inventory management, ensuring alignment with accumulations, utilization, and purchase invoices to prevent 340B diversion and GPO Prohibition.
  • Review inpatient and outpatient charges, along with outpatient retail-pharmacy claims, for appropriate 340B, GPO, and WAC account accumulations.
  • Conduct regular 340B associated compliance audits and monitoring, maintaining a current state of "audit readiness."
  • Develop, implement, and modify consistent policies and procedures for the 340B program, ensuring that they support maximum productivity and efficiency and are in compliance with all applicable guidelines.
  • Stay abreast of 340B regulations to ensure federal compliance, keeping up-to-date on all rule changes and sharing learnings with management and staff.
  • Support the registration/recertification processes, ensuring accuracy in the HRSA 340B Database for all organization entities and timely registration of new sites.
